
-
全部
-
網(wǎng)路3.0
-
後端開發(fā)
-
web前端
-
資料庫(kù)
-
運(yùn)維
-
開發(fā)工具
-
php框架
-
常見問題
-
其他
-
科技
-
CMS教程
-
Java
-
系統(tǒng)教程
-
電腦教學(xué)
-
硬體教學(xué)
-
手機(jī)教學(xué)
-
軟體教學(xué)
-
手遊教學(xué)

在Gradle項(xiàng)目中配置Java 19預(yù)覽與孵化器特性
本文詳細(xì)指導(dǎo)如何在Gradle項(xiàng)目中啟用Java 19的預(yù)覽(如虛擬線程)和孵化器(如結(jié)構(gòu)化並發(fā))特性。通過配置compileJava任務(wù)的編譯器參數(shù)和application插件的JVM啟動(dòng)參數(shù),開發(fā)者可以無縫集成並體驗(yàn)Java平臺(tái)的新功能,確保編譯和運(yùn)行階段均正確識(shí)別和使用這些實(shí)驗(yàn)性API。這將涉及設(shè)置--release、--enable-preview和--add-modules等關(guān)鍵命令行標(biāo)誌,以適應(yīng)不同階段的需求。此教程旨在提供清晰、可操作的步驟,幫助您在Gradle環(huán)境中順利探索Jav
Sep 04, 2025 am 08:48 AM
如何在Java中創(chuàng)建二維陣列
在Java中創(chuàng)建二維數(shù)組有三種主要方式:1.使用固定大小並初始化默認(rèn)值,如int[][]array=newint[3][4];,創(chuàng)建一個(gè)3行4列的數(shù)組,元素默認(rèn)為0;2.直接初始化指定值,如int[][]array={{1,2,3},{4,5,6},{7,8,9}};,創(chuàng)建一個(gè)3x3的二維數(shù)組並賦值;3.創(chuàng)建不規(guī)則(鋸齒狀)數(shù)組,如int[][]raggedArray={{1,2},{3,4,5,6},{7}};,每行長(zhǎng)度可不同;可通過array[i][j]訪問或修改元素,並使用嵌套for循環(huán)或
Sep 04, 2025 am 08:45 AM
掌握J(rèn)Unit 5參數(shù)化測(cè)試:高效測(cè)試Switch-Case邏輯與最佳實(shí)踐
本教程詳細(xì)講解如何使用JUnit 5的@ParameterizedTest註解高效測(cè)試Java中的switch-case邏輯。文章深入分析了JUnit 4與JUnit 5註解混用的常見問題,強(qiáng)調(diào)了分離業(yè)務(wù)邏輯與I/O操作的重要性,並提供了清晰的示例代碼,指導(dǎo)讀者如何通過參數(shù)化測(cè)試和依賴注入有效覆蓋不同分支,提升測(cè)試效率與代碼可維護(hù)性。
Sep 04, 2025 am 08:33 AM
如何在Java gRPC服務(wù)中實(shí)現(xiàn)列表方法的重寫
本文介紹瞭如何在Java gRPC服務(wù)中重寫列表方法,以返回包含所有已創(chuàng)建條目的對(duì)象。通過構(gòu)造 ListPersonsResponse 對(duì)象並使用 responseObserver.onNext() 方法發(fā)送響應(yīng),可以輕鬆實(shí)現(xiàn)列表數(shù)據(jù)的返回,無需複雜的流處理。
Sep 04, 2025 am 08:21 AM
如何使用Java使用彈簧框架
startbysettingupaspringprojectusingsingspringinitializrormanalywithmaven,2。 ExtersandCoreconceptSlikedSlikEdentionInctionIn和ComponentsCanningWherESpringManagesBeanagesBeansBeansBeansBeanSandtheirdTheirdTheirdTheirdEppities,3.BuildawebapplicationBapplicationBapplicationByCreatinga@restContontrolllollererWithEndEndeNendpointsseendeendeendpointse,4.4.4.Extee
Sep 04, 2025 am 07:59 AM
帶有RabbitMQ和AMQP的高性能Java消息傳遞
使用官方RabbitMQJava客戶端並複用連接、避免跨線程共享通道以提升基礎(chǔ)性能;2.啟用發(fā)布確認(rèn)(異步或批量)和按需設(shè)置消息持久化以在可靠性與吞吐量間取得平衡;3.通過basicQos控制預(yù)取數(shù)量並使用手動(dòng)確認(rèn)避免消息丟失,確保消費(fèi)者高效處理;4.配置合理的心跳、低延遲網(wǎng)絡(luò)部署、必要時(shí)啟用TLS並結(jié)合SSD與集群提升整體穩(wěn)定性;5.利用管理界面、Prometheus或壓力測(cè)試工具監(jiān)控發(fā)布/消費(fèi)速率、隊(duì)列長(zhǎng)度及JVMGC情況,持續(xù)優(yōu)化系統(tǒng)表現(xiàn)。通過合理配置AMQP客戶端與基礎(chǔ)設(shè)施,Java應(yīng)用
Sep 04, 2025 am 07:54 AM
基於頻率排序字符串?dāng)?shù)組:Java 教程
本文介紹了一種在 Java 中基於另一個(gè)整數(shù)數(shù)組(頻率)對(duì)字符串?dāng)?shù)組進(jìn)行排序的有效方法。通過使用 IntStream 和 Comparator,我們可以創(chuàng)建一個(gè)索引流,根據(jù)頻率數(shù)組的值對(duì)其進(jìn)行排序,然後使用排序後的索引來映射原始字符串?dāng)?shù)組,從而獲得所需的排序結(jié)果。本教程提供了詳細(xì)的代碼示例和解釋,幫助你理解和應(yīng)用這種技術(shù)。
Sep 04, 2025 am 07:27 AM
如何在Java中獲得陣列的長(zhǎng)度
要獲取Java中數(shù)組的長(zhǎng)度,應(yīng)使用length屬性;1.使用arrayName.length語(yǔ)法直接訪問長(zhǎng)度,無需括號(hào);2.它返回?cái)?shù)組元素?cái)?shù)量的整數(shù)值,適用於所有類型數(shù)組如int[]、String[]等;3.數(shù)組長(zhǎng)度在創(chuàng)建時(shí)確定且不可變;4.常用於循環(huán)遍歷,避免硬編碼;5.對(duì)於二維數(shù)組,array.length表示行數(shù),array[i].length表示第i行的列數(shù)。因此,只需記住使用array.length即可準(zhǔn)確獲取數(shù)組長(zhǎng)度。
Sep 04, 2025 am 07:26 AM
如何附加到Java中的文件?
toAppendToFileInjava,usefileWriterWithThesecondParameterTotRueToEnableAbleAppendMode.2.forBetterPerformancewhenWritingMultiplesMallStrings,wrapffilewriterInabufferredWriter.3.inmodernjavaversions.3.inmodernjavaversions,usefilefiles.usefiles.usefiles.write.write)
Sep 04, 2025 am 05:44 AM
Log4j 1.x 遷移至 Log4j 2.x:解決XML配置命名空間綁定問題
本文檔旨在幫助開發(fā)者將Log4j 1.x項(xiàng)目遷移至Log4j 2.x,並解決在遷移過程中可能出現(xiàn)的XML配置文件命名空間綁定錯(cuò)誤。文章詳細(xì)介紹瞭如何更新依賴、修改代碼以及調(diào)整XML配置文件,以確保項(xiàng)目成功過渡到Log4j 2.x,並避免常見的配置問題。通過本文,讀者可以掌握Log4j 2.x的配置方法,並順利完成項(xiàng)目升級(jí)。
Sep 04, 2025 am 05:39 AM
LWJGL Scala開發(fā)中g(shù)lClear運(yùn)行時(shí)錯(cuò)誤的根源與解決方案
本文探討了在LWJGL Scala應(yīng)用中調(diào)用glClear時(shí)遇到的運(yùn)行時(shí)錯(cuò)誤,該錯(cuò)誤通常表現(xiàn)為“無當(dāng)前上下文”。文章指出,glClear並非問題根源,而是未能正確初始化OpenGL上下文的癥狀。通過詳細(xì)解析OpenGL上下文的建立流程,特別是GL.createCapabilities()的關(guān)鍵作用,並提供修正後的代碼示例,幫助開發(fā)者解決此類問題,確保OpenGL渲染環(huán)境的正確配置。
Sep 04, 2025 am 05:36 AM
Java中的多線程是什麼?
MultithreadinginJavaallowsaprogramtoexecutemultipletasksconcurrentlywithinasingleprocessbyusingthreads,whicharethesmallestunitsofexecution;itenhancesperformancebyutilizingCPUresourcesefficiently,especiallyonmulti-coresystems,andenablesresponsivenessi
Sep 04, 2025 am 05:24 AM
使用 Java Stream API 查找 List 中具有最大值的 Map
本文介紹瞭如何使用 Java Stream API 在 List 中查找具有最大 "Length" 值的 Map,並探討了使用自定義對(duì)象而非 Map 的優(yōu)勢(shì)。同時(shí),提供了查找單個(gè)最大元素和查找所有具有最大值的元素集合的示例代碼,並討論了使用 Stream API 和 Collections.max() 的不同方法。
Sep 04, 2025 am 04:54 AM
C# .NET中基於JWT和外部授權(quán)服務(wù)器的REST API安全配置指南
本文旨在提供一個(gè)簡(jiǎn)潔明了的教程,指導(dǎo)開發(fā)者如何在C# .NET應(yīng)用中,以純資源服務(wù)器模式,通過外部授權(quán)服務(wù)器(如AWS Cognito或Asgardeo)實(shí)現(xiàn)REST API的安全保護(hù)。文章將重點(diǎn)介紹如何利用JWT Bearer認(rèn)證機(jī)制,通過最小化配置,快速構(gòu)建一個(gè)能夠驗(yàn)證傳入訪問令牌的API服務(wù),無需深度集成用戶管理功能。
Sep 04, 2025 am 04:36 AM
熱門工具標(biāo)籤

Undress AI Tool
免費(fèi)脫衣圖片

Undresser.AI Undress
人工智慧驅(qū)動(dòng)的應(yīng)用程序,用於創(chuàng)建逼真的裸體照片

AI Clothes Remover
用於從照片中去除衣服的線上人工智慧工具。

Stock Market GPT
人工智慧支援投資研究,做出更明智的決策

熱門文章

熱工具

vc9-vc14(32+64位元)運(yùn)行庫(kù)合集(連結(jié)在下方)
phpStudy安裝所需運(yùn)行函式庫(kù)集合下載

VC9 32位
VC9 32位元 phpstudy整合安裝環(huán)境運(yùn)行庫(kù)

php程式設(shè)計(jì)師工具箱完整版
程式設(shè)計(jì)師工具箱 v1.0 php整合環(huán)境

VC11 32位
VC11 32位元 phpstudy整合安裝環(huán)境運(yùn)行庫(kù)

SublimeText3漢化版
中文版,非常好用